Word | Definition |
bon voyage | phrase used to express farewell and good wishes to a departing traveler |
bonbon | a good French confectionary |
benevolent | characterized by goodwill or kind feelings; concerned with or organized for the benefit of charity or helping others |
bon mots | a clever saying or witty saying; a good joke |
bounteous | generous; a good many; plentiful; given freely |
bona fide | Authentic; genuine; believed to be fair |
bounty | a reward, bonus, or payment; goodness or a generous gift |
benison | a blessing; good praise |
benediction | a prayer of spiritual blessing; a religious ceremony or special service |
benign | having a kindly disposition; showing gentleness or kindness; favorable; of no danger |
